Output e177594e72d495fb5d82119b9764282ae70f08ea55bf290e2516a9e4e7eadc50:0

value
9515640
script pubkey
OP_0 OP_PUSHBYTES_20 168bdb61ce89369a44a229b4e8c50ba5d823dbd6
address
bc1qz69akcww3ymf539z9x6w33gt5hvz8k7klrccfd
transaction
e177594e72d495fb5d82119b9764282ae70f08ea55bf290e2516a9e4e7eadc50
spent
true